The summer has gone faster than the blink of an eye, and Grandparents Day is almost here. If you haven’t made plans yet, now’s the time!

Connecting with the generations above us can teach us a lot. A great first step to making the most of any visit is offering your full attention without distractions.

If you have to use your phone while you’re together, bring it to show your loved ones all your latest pictures to bring them up to speed on everything you’ve been up to lately. Sharing your photos and stories could spark fun memories they’ll share with you, too!

Celebrating Grandparents Day is all about family and togetherness. If you have small children, bring them to see their grandparents. Encourage older children to make the time to visit their grandparents as well to keep the holiday alive!

Celebration Ideas for Grandparents Day:

If your grandparents reside in a senior living community, visit them. Chances are, there’s a celebration event planned. Call ahead and get the scoop before you visit. Most importantly, be sure to acknowledge Grandparents Day and make your loved ones feel special and honored that you took the time.
